I was scheduled for March 18. My docs office submitted to my insurance (BCBSNC) and the insurance company immediately denied it because they said my docs hospital was not a blue "distinction" hospital. When I began this journey I specifically asked my insurance if the hospital was a distinction center and they told me they were. Also' date=' my docs office confirmed this before my first visit. Now they say there is nothing I can do except find a blue distinction center. I'm hoping that I won't have to go through the entire process again. Looking on the bright side, I could possibly get an earlier surgery date.[/quote']

Fergie0308, what happened with your surgery? Did you get BCBSNC to cover it? I have them also and are just about ready to submit for approval so I'm really curious to hear your story. The only doctor I could find is also not in a blue distinction hospital but I don't recall reading anything about that as a requirement under the BCBSNC coverage guidelines. Any advice you can offer would be greatly appreciated!
